c语言中#include<math.h> include"math.h"的区别

c语言中#include<math.h> include"math.h"的区别

实际上没啥区别的,都可以使用的
注意一下就行啦
(1)如果头文件是系统自带的,比如"stdio","math","string";就使用尖括号<>
(2)如果是自己编写的头文件,就是用引号"";

呵呵,简单吧
温馨提示:内容为网友见解,仅供参考
第1个回答  2008-06-19
上面两种写法的区别是:
对于前者,系统将直接在系统的库函数文件目录下去找该文件;
对于后者,系统将首先在用户当前工作目录下许找该文件,如果没有,再去系统的库函数文件目录下找。

参考资料:《C语言实例教程》 P36

本回答被提问者采纳
第2个回答  2008-06-19
#include<math.h>:表示编译器将从标准库目录开始搜索
#include"math.h":表示编译器将从用户的工作目录开始搜索
第3个回答  2008-06-19
没区别,在这里""和<>作用是相同的
第4个回答  2008-06-19
CreateObject("ADODB.Connection")

c语言中#include<math.h> include"math.h"的区别
实际上没啥区别的,都可以使用的 注意一下就行啦 (1)如果头文件是系统自带的,比如"stdio","math","string";就使用尖括号<> (2)如果是自己编写的头文件,就是用引号"";呵呵,简单吧

在C语言宏定义中#include <maths.h>和include "maths.h"有什么不同...
当然不一样了,<>只是在本程序下搜索,“”是先在所有目录中搜索,搜索不到后才在本程序下搜索,一般用<>比较快点

C语言中的(#include<stdio.h>和#include<math.h>)是什么意思?
math.h一般见于C程序设计,#include<math.h> 是包含math头文件的意思, .h是头文件的扩展名(header file),这一句声明了本程序要用到标准库中的 math.h文件。

看看。解释一下。c语言 #include <stdio.h> #include <math.h>
头文件啊,math包含数学函数的头文件,而stdio包含输入输出函数的头文件,你这段代码用不到math,所以include math.h应该删了没事

C语言中#include<stdio.h>与#include<math.h>
Stdio.h是输入\/输出函数的时候用的头文件! math.h是用到数学函数时候、用的头文件! 例如:求绝对值函数、开平方函数

C语言,为什么在这里会出现#include<math.h>,这个#include<math.h>是...
math.h 是个包含了数学运算的函数库 sqrt() 这个求平方根函数是包含在math.h里的 你要用他就得包含这个库

c语言中 #include <math.h>是什么意思
include<math.h> 意思是包含math库,实际上就是一个头文件,里面是一些已经写好的代码,形式上是一个个的函数,包含进来以后就可以使用里面的各种数学函数,如幂函数、三角函数、指数函数等。

...在程序开头加一条#include指令,把头文件“math
那个#include 的意思就是包含的意思,这个语句是c编译软件的预处理语句,本身不是c语言的语法。也就是提供给编译器在生成最终应用程序之前用的。比如#include “math.h” 就是把math.h 这个文件里的内容简单的复制到当前位置来,里面有定义好的关于数学运算的函数之类的,而函数是必须要先定义,后...

#include<cmath>与#include<math.h>的区别
用后面那个就好 #include <math.h> 前面那个如果没有C++对应的库会出错 用后面的一定不会出错

...c语言。帮帮忙。帮忙解释一下 #include<stdio.h> #include<math.
include<math.h> \/\/包含数学函数头文件 void main() \/\/定义主函数,void表示无返回值 { float a,b; \/\/定义两个浮点变量,a和b printf("\\n input a:"); \/\/输出input a 到屏幕,\\n表示换行 scanf( "%f,&a" ); \/\/从键盘输入一个浮点类型的数,赋值给a变量 printf( ...

相似回答